This last weekend I bought the three camera Arlo Pro System in Costco and I have been testing the system since then. However, I am having issues with the audio coming out from the Camera speaker, this is very very weak in each one of the cameras, and pretty much nobody can hear what I am saying when using the Arlo App in my Galaxy 7 Samsung.  I have checked the volume setting for each one of the Camera using the app and this is a 100%. I must say that I am getting a very good quality imagen and sound in my cellphone from each Camera, so my only  issue  is basically the sound coming out from the Camera speaker. As far I know I have downloaded the latest available firmware for each one of the components (Camera 1.092.0.3_12290  receptor 1.8.9.0_11528) as well as the latest version of the app for my cellphone (android galaxy 7, Arlo app version 2.4.2_17124).

 

What should I do ? How this issue can be solve? Please advise

The audio level coming out of android has been an issue NG has been working on for a while... others have complained too.

 

The only thing I can recommend ( have an S7 too ) is try it on speaker phone or an ear bud mic if you have one. the major issue is the lack of mic control in the unit ( unlike a pc where you have an adjustable mic input )

This is what I just posted on another thread:

I just bought this system and am having the same issue. I tried the “tap” test and found that the sound is not picking up from the iPhone mic; it’s more responsive at the “noise canceling” mic next to the rear camera. This is bad software engineering. The sound is still whisper quiet if you try to use the noise cancelling mic.

Logic would dictate that reversing the roles of both mics would lower the output to the Arlo Pro cam. The rear mic on the iPhone is used to detect background noise and erase it from the main mic. If you reverse this, the main mic would pick up louder sound and cancel out the rear mic almost completely.

This is most likely the cause for the whisper quiet output from the Arlo Pro can. Netgear needs to correct their application!
